What is this trial about?

The current standard treatment for advanced bile duct or gallbladder cancer is a combination of chemotherapy and immunotherapy. Pembrolizumab and trastuzumab are immunotherapies that are already approved for other types of cancer and could represent a treatment option for cancers of the biliary tract. The goal of the TRAP-BTC study is to determine whether a new combination of chemotherapy (gemcitabine and cisplatin) with the antibodies pembrolizumab and trastuzumab is more effective and just as safe as the current standard of care. Eligible participants include women and men aged 18 and older with HER2-positive, previously untreated bile duct or gallbladder cancer.

Detailed description

Bile duct and gallbladder cancers are rare cancers that are usually detected at a late stage. In advanced stages, a cure is generally no longer possible, which is why treatment aims to slow the progression of the disease and alleviate tumor-related symptoms. The current standard of care consists of a combination of the chemotherapy drugs gemcitabine and cisplatin with the antibody durvalumab. This so-called immunochemotherapy is intended to improve quality of life and prolong life expectancy. The TRAP-BTC study is now investigating an alternative combination in which the antibodies pembrolizumab and trastuzumab are used in place of durvalumab, in conjunction with standard chemotherapy. Pembrolizumab is a so-called immune checkpoint inhibitor. It strengthens the body’s own immune system by releasing a “brake” on the immune system (the PD-1 signaling pathway). This allows immune cells to once again actively attack cancer cells. Trastuzumab is a targeted drug that acts against the HER2 surface protein, which is present in elevated levels in some tumors. Blocking this signal inhibits the growth of cancer cells and can also stimulate the immune system to destroy the tumor cells. Both drugs are already approved for the treatment of other types of cancer, such as breast or stomach cancer, but not yet for bile duct cancer.

The goal of this Phase 2 study is to investigate whether the combination of these two antibodies with standard chemotherapy can control the disease more effectively than the current treatment. It is being conducted at approximately six centers in Germany and includes a total of 24 study participants.

Following a screening phase, a treatment phase lasting approximately 24 months will begin, consisting of up to 35 treatment cycles, each lasting three weeks. This is followed by a follow-up period during which patients are examined or contacted every three months. During the treatment phase, regular blood tests, physical examinations, and imaging procedures (computed tomography or magnetic resonance imaging) are performed to monitor the course of the disease.

Women and men aged 18 and older with confirmed HER2-positive bile duct or gallbladder cancer who have not yet received systemic treatment are eligible to participate in this study. Patients must not have any serious comorbidities, particularly severe heart or autoimmune diseases. Pregnancy and breastfeeding also exclude participation. In addition, there is a voluntary accompanying research program. In this program, tumor and blood samples are analyzed for research purposes to better understand how the medications work and which biological characteristics influence the success of treatment. These analyses are intended solely for research and have no impact on individual treatment.
